Letter from H. G. Keene about the cost of the College servants and reporting the deaths of Joseph Malton, waiter, Richard Cordell, shoe and knife cleaner, and Mrs Bankes, housekeeper, and arrangements for their replacement, 1 & 9 Mar 1832
Letter from H. G. Keene about the need for a special office for the Registrar and asking for repayment of £45 which Caleb Hitch charged him for converting his pantry into a study for this purpose, 9 Jun 1832
